What We Do:

Founded in 1995, RYA Sailability has recently been incorporated into the Royal Yachting Association absorbing core administrative costs. Currently there are more than 20,000 disabled sailors in the UK helped by around 12,000 volunteers at over 150 recognised RYA Sailability sites. Through the charities work, sailors with disabilities experience the same exhilaration, enjoyment and confidence felt by able-bodied sailors - along with all the great social activities and competition opportunities.

What we do:

■ Give grants to adapt facilities at club houses; ■ Give grants to RYA Sailability groups to buy equipment and specially adapted boats; ■ Train volunteers and instructors to help disabled sailors get out on the water; ■ Promote powerboating for disabled people; ■ Help groups to raise money locally; ■ Fund 15 volunteer regional coordinator; ■ Support paralympic potential and help with funding for racing both nationally and abroad; ■ Encourage and support clubs to share facilities; ■ Help to set up new RYA Sailability groups.
